WEBINAR OVERVIEW

2020 was a transformational year for the beauty and cosmetics industry. In just 12 months, the way we interact with beauty brands and retail has been pushed further than ever into the digital space.

This has presented myriad challenges for beauty brands in how to better reach, transact, and connect with customers without physical touchpoints.

Threepipe Reply and Arthur Edward Recruitment hosted this webinar and panel event to discuss how the beauty industry is continually innovating to build deeper relationships with consumers.

Also covered:

  • An overview of recent innovations (products and marketing) in the beauty sector
  • How teams can upskill in digital marketing and eCommerce

Heidi Bannister – Founder & CEO at Arthur Edwards

Heidi Bannister is Founder and Managing Director of Arthur Edward Recruitment. She has worked in FMCG recruitment since 1998 and exclusively within the cosmetic and personal care industry for almost 20 years. Initially trained in Hair and Beauty, Heidi was awarded Student of the Year at the London College of Fashion in 1984. In 1988 she won the London Livewire Business competition, securing 3i investment for a small manufacturing operation that she had set up at the kitchen sink. A self-confessed product junkie, Heidi spent 15 years in beauty and skincare product development, sales and marketing positions for manufacturers and brand owners.
